Shenzhen: A Brief Overview

Before delving into the city's transformation, it's essential to understand Shenzhen's historical context. Shenzhen was a sleepy fishing village just a few decades ago. However, in 1980, it was designated as China's first Special Economic Zone (SEZ). This marked the beginning of a remarkable transformation. The city's strategic location near Hong Kong, along with favorable economic policies, attracted domestic and international investment, propelling it into a booming metropolis.

Green Transportation

Shenzhen boasts an extensive public transportation system that prioritizes sustainability. The city is known for its electric buses and a growing fleet of electric taxis. This shift to electric vehicles has significantly reduced air pollution and greenhouse gas emissions.
